Politically Segregated
“As people seek out the social settings they prefer—as they choose the
group that makes them feel the most comfortable—the nation grows more
politically segregated—and the benefit that ought to come with having a
variety of opinions is lost to the righteousness that is the special
entitlement of homogeneous groups... Like-minded, homogeneous groups
squelch dissent, grow more extreme in their thinking, and ignore
evidence that their positions are wrong. As a result, we now live in a
giant feedback loop, hearing our own thoughts about what's right and
wrong bounced back to us by the television shows we watch, the
newspapers and books we read, the blogs we visit online, the sermons we
hear, and the neighborhoods we live in.” — Bill Bishop, “The Big Sort”
